Ford Kuga Tyres

As a family-first SUV, the Ford Kuga needs tyres that provide grip and control in wet weather, as well as smooth and composed driving, during the school and family runs, as well as everyday commuting and longer journeys. The Ford Kuga’s tyres should also provide good performance and durability in wet weather and have a low rolling resistance to improve everyday driving and provide the Ford Kuga with the best of its fuel or energy use.

The different generations and model years of the Ford Kuga have different Ford Kuga tyre sizes, depending on the trim level, engine option and factory fitted wheels. The correct fitting and the required load index and speed rating can be verified using the existing tyre sidewall, the vehicle handbook or registration details. The correct Ford Kuga tyre specification will support the safety, handling and comfort of the vehicle. Ensuring the Ford Kuga has a verified fitment of tyre will also ensure that the SUV has the correct steering and driving control for the intended daily driving routes.

Buying and Fitting Ford Kuga Tyres: FAQ

When purchasing a 2020 Kuga III 2.0 EcoBlue 190 AWD from Tyres.co.uk, Ford Kuga tyre options include the Continental UltraContact and Bridgestone Alenza 001 in 225/60 R18 100H. Please confirm the registration along with the placard details, including load index, speed rating, and construction in case of an order for XL.

The tyre size for Ford Kuga can be found on the tyre-information placard located on the driver's side B-pillar, visible when the driver's door is open. The placard displays the approved tyre size as well as the load and speed ratings, and the recommended cold pressure. Please compare this with the tyre sidewall and registration as wheel options differ by version.

Normally, you do not replace all four tyres on a Ford Kuga. Replace tyres on an axle pair basis, and put any new pair on the back axle. For Ford Kuga AWD versions, all four tyres must be of the same size, construction and closely matched rolling circumference and tread. Replace all four tyres if this condition cannot be met.
